Description (What the record is about)
-
No title. Endorsed 'Chard Manor Contains 4837 Acres. Survey'd in the Year 1799'.
Approx. 19" to 1m. O.S. sheets 87SE; 88SW; 91NE,SE; 92NW,SW.
Ink and water colour on paper.
?Whole parish. Field names and acreages, place names given. Parts of the map have been cut out and remounted. Appears to be a surveyor's working map.
